The aerobic cellular respiration equation is a fundamental concept in biology, representing the process by which cells convert nutrients into energy, specifically in the presence of oxygen. This complex biochemical pathway is essential for the survival of most living organisms, from single-celled bacteria to complex multicellular animals.

At its core, the equation describes the conversion of glucose (a simple sugar) into adenosine triphosphate (ATP), the primary energy currency of cells. This process occurs in a series of steps, each carefully regulated to ensure efficiency and optimal energy production.

The equation can be simplified to: Glucose + Oxygen → Carbon Dioxide + Water + ATP. This formula highlights the key inputs and outputs of the process, showcasing the role of oxygen in facilitating the breakdown of glucose and the subsequent production of energy.

The benefits of this process are profound. It provides the energy required for various cellular functions, including muscle contraction, nerve impulse propagation, and the synthesis of essential biomolecules. The efficient production of ATP ensures that cells have the necessary fuel to carry out their specialized roles in the body.
